#050122 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#050122 is composed of 2% red, 0.4%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.3% cyan, 97.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 86.7% black. It has a hue angle of 247.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 6.9%. #050122 color hex could be obtained by blending #0a0244 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

● #050122 color description : Very dark (mostly black) blue.
#050122 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#050122 has RGB values of R:5, G:1,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.87. Its decimal value is 327970.
